Right out of the gate in 1968, AMC campaigned the Javelin in professional racing. By mid-1970, the Javelin was a respected member of the field, staving off Camaros, Challengers, 'Cudas, and most notably, Mustangs. Piloted by Mark Donahue, the Javelin effort was super successful, taking the Trans Am championships for 1971, 1972 and 1975.

Extremely Rare 1 of 100 Built 1970 AMC Javelin SST 390 Trans Am Edition


Built in September 1969 and announced as limited to 100 examples from the very start, the cars were all constructed identically, with 390/four-speed/3.91 driveline combos and special options as.

1970 AMC Javelin SST TransAm LaVine Restorations


When all was said and done, only 100 1970 AMC Javelin SST Trans Am coupes were built to comply with the SCCA's current homologation requirements. In a twist of fate, though, the rules had been changed during the Trans Am's production, requiring AMC to build 2,500 "Mark Donohue" models of a differing spec to comply.

The 1970 Trans-Am series is regarded by most racing historians as the high water mark of American road racing. Every "pony car" manufacturer was represented with a factory team and top driving talent. Roger Penske's Sunoco AMC Javelin team starred Mark Donohue and Peter Revson.
